The Voice in the Mirror (Nightmare Hall)

by Diane Hoh

Salem U. is buzzing with holiday activities. Annie loves the holidays, until two of her friends have horrible accidents—and she may be next. What Annie doesn't know is that one of her friends has a dark past. He has murdered a girl and now his mind is split in two. One part that of a student, the other that of a guilty killer. He listens to "the voice in the mirror" that tells him that each new girl he meets is actually a reincarnation of the girl he killed, returning to expose him. The voice tells him he has no chance, unless he can eliminate the problem...permanently.
